We teach physical education at a Title I school in a fully inclusive environment. All of our students receive free or reduced-price lunch. A lot of our students also participate consistently in our after school sports program. The purpose of our physical education classes and after school program is to help motivate our students to practice and continue a healthy lifestyle.
With students away from campus right now due to COVID-19, our PE department wants to fund basic equipment for students to be able to take home and still be engaged in physical activity.
Our hope is to stay connected with our students and offer fitness videos that they can do on their own, showing them they can still be active on their own. This will help teach our students how to maintain their fitness goals and start to understand the importance of lifelong fitness.
We also have many English language learners at our site. In order to continually support our English language learners across content areas, we continually implement various strategies in P.E. to help support their language development. We want to help support all our students in all areas of their life.
My Project
This project will fund jump ropes and resistance bands that will allow our students to stay physically active while away from school.
They can learn how to use equipment for engaging in fitness exercises and begin to develop skills needed to carry on throughout their adulthood.
With the uncertainty of how long students will be away from school, students can pick up equipment and take it home. PE teachers will be posting fitness workouts that will use jump ropes, resistance bands, and other suggested household materials to virtually interact with students and teach students you do not need a fancy gym membership to stay fit and have fun doing it!
